    What engines are a direct bolt on for a 2011 my 12 T5 multivan? It has a TDI400 in it at the moment but maybe has some major issues. Will an amarok TDI400 fit?

      Block is probably the same, but the rest will be different.

      Better to find one with the same engine code.

                            Originally posted by frantic View Post
                            Also to link the old transmission mechatronics to a new engine will require either a vw dealer or a mechanic with access to the codes.
                            Not true.

                            ECU doesn't get changed when the engine is replaced like-for-like, therefore the Mechatronics won't be affected.
